WebShared Piano. New Room. Help. Back to live Song Saved Live 0 people. Room: z7D0ZwqUX (Copy link) Loading… Clear. Settings. Share. Save ... WebSome chord shapes feel awkward no matter what. The more you have to isolate your pinky from your other fingers, the more awkward the chord is. Hand size, strength, and flexiblity make a big difference. There are a lot of pieces that I consider insanely difficult that I'd change my rating to moderately difficult if I could comfortably reach a 10th.

WebJan 10, 2024 · The first chord you can make is called the C major triad. This chord is formed of three notes: a root note, a third, and a fifth note. So what does that look like applied to the key of C major? It looks like the notes C – E – G.
